Can I make this in the microwave?

There are recipes out there for microwave hot fudge, but the best results for homemade hot fudge sauce are achieved through cooking on a traditional stovetop. The heat in microwaves just isn’t as reliable. This recipe is best made on the stovetop—it is still simple and quick to make.

Cooking Tips:

The cooking allows the sugar to bind with the other ingredients; too hot, and the sugar burns, too cool or too short, and the sugar could end up grainy or crystallized. The blending has to do with working air into the sauce or aerating it. The smooth, creamy texture is a result of this blending, so be sure to blend for the full two minutes, even if it seems pretty well blended before that. Also, an immersion blender doesn’t work great for this step. Both the temperature and the time are key here, so be ready with your ingredients and a timer—you will love the result!

A common mistake in candy making is cooking the sugar too fast. When a candy recipe says “bring to a boil” you should warm it at low-medium heat until everything is melted, then turn the heat up to medium-high until boiling begins. Then, always reduce the heat to medium to sustain a simmering boil. If you just flip the heat up to high, you risk burning or otherwise ruining your sugar.Doubling a candy recipe can be difficult as it affects the cooking time, pot size, and more. Substitutions are unpredictable in candy making because each ingredient has a very specific purpose. This is cooking chemistry. Unless you are an experienced candy maker, just stick to the recipe.

Will the sugar crystallize?

Crystallizing is pretty common when working with sugar, but by heating the sugar just right, you can avoid that crystallization. Be sure to follow the cooking and blending very closely.

Does hot fudge sauce need to be refrigerated?

We recommend storing the fudge sauce in the refrigerator. There is probably enough sugar in it to keep fine at room temperature, but it is always safer in the fridge and will keep fresher. Reheat in the microwave in small, 20-30 second increments of time.

Storage Instructions:

This sauce can be used for up to one month if kept in the refrigerator. If you bottle this to store it, using professional bottling techniques after you make it, it will last from 6-12 months, unopened, in the fridge.

Best Hot Fudge Sauce
Rating

Servings

3 cups

Best Hot Fudge Sauce (3)

The Best Hot Fudge Sauce is easy to make and beats store bought options. It turns out thick, gooey, fudgy and delicious—perfect every time!

Prep Time 5 minutes

Cook Time 10 minutes

Total Time 15 minutes

Ingredients

  • 1/2 cup salted butter
  • 1/3 cup unsweetened cocoa powder
  • 2/3 cup milk chocolate chips
  • 2 cups granulated sugar
  • 12 ounce can evaporated milk
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ract

US CustomaryMetric

Instructions

  • In a medium saucepan combine butter, cocoa powder, chocolate chips, sugar, and evaporated milk. Stir to combine over medium-low heat.

  • Increase heat to medium-high and bring to a boil. Immediately reduce heat to low and continue simmering for 7 minutes, stirring constantly.

  • Remove from heat and add vanilla.

  • Pour the mixture into a blender and blend the mixture for 2 whole minutes.

  • Serve immediately or pour into a heat safe airtight container to store.

Notes

Store in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 1 month. Reheat portions by spooning into a microwave safe bowl and microwave in 10 second increments until warm.

What's the difference between hot fudge and chocolate sauce? ›

The big difference between hot fudge and chocolate sauce is the texture. Hot fudge tends to be thicker and more indulgent, while chocolate sauce is noticeably thinner. Chocolate sauce also has sugar and water or corn syrup, while hot fudge uses heavier ingredients like cream and butter.

Why is my homemade hot fudge sauce grainy? ›

Why is my hot fudge sauce grainy? A common mistake is overcooking or overheating the sauce which can turn it grainy. Cooling the sauce too quickly can also cause it to become grainy. It's best to let it cool at room temperature until it's completely cool before refrigerating it.

What is the secret to perfect fudge? ›

It's the size of sugar crystals that makes the knees of fudge lovers buckle…the smaller the crystals, the less they are perceived on the tongue and the more the fudge tastes smooth and creamy. Cooking, and beating after cooking, is the key to successful fudge.

What is the secret to smooth fudge that is not gritty? ›

The key to successful, nongrainy fudge is in the cooling, not the cooking. The recipe calls for heating the ingredients to the soft-ball stage, or 234° F, then allowing it to cool undisturbed to approximately 110° F.

What causes fudge to get too hard? ›

If your fudge is tough, hard, or grainy, then you may have made one of several mistakes: You may have overcooked it, beaten it too long, or neglected to cool it to the proper temperature. Don't throw out the whole pan, because you may be able to melt the fudge down and try again.

Is it better to use margarine or butter in fudge? ›

When making fudge, be sure to use good quality butter and do not substitute margarine. Margarine contains more water and can prevent the fudge from setting up properly. Also, be sure to use the quantity called for in the recipe, too much may prevent it from firming up properly.

Why is a hot fudge sundae called a Sunday? ›

A pharmacist named Charles Sonntag created the treat, naming it the “sonntag” after himself. Sonntag means Sunday in German, and so the name was translated to Sunday, and later spelled as “sundae”.

Why was fudge called fudge? ›

The exact origin and inventor of this delicious confection are hotly debated. However, many believe the first batch of fudge was created by accident when American bakers “fudged” a batch of caramels. Hence the name “fudge.”

What is the difference between chocolate and fudge? ›

Although fudge often contains chocolate, fudge is not the same as chocolate. Chocolate is a mix of cocoa solids, cocoa butter and sometimes sugar and other flavorings and is hard and brittle. Fudge is a mixture of sugar, dairy and flavorings that is cooked and cooled to form a smooth, semi-soft confection.

What is the difference between chocolate sauce and chocolate syrup? ›

These terms are often used interchangeably. Technically, chocolate syrup is usually made with water and without added fat, whereas chocolate sauce usually includes some kind of fat (milk, butter, cream, etc.). Both terms refer to pourable chocolate sauce that's thinner than hot fudge.
